Karan Singh enters this ATP Challenger Bengaluru 3 first-round match on hard courts holding the higher ranking at world No. 413 compared with Mitsuki Wei Kang Leong’s No. 634. The 22-year-old Indian has shown recent form with victories over Ryotaro Taguchi and another opponent in April, though he dropped a match to Sanhui Shin in mid-April. Leong, 21, brings a head-to-head edge after defeating Singh in their only prior meeting last year. Home-country support and familiarity with Indian hard-court conditions could provide Singh a slight edge in this low-stakes Challenger encounter, while both players remain early in their professional development with limited experience at this level. The outcome hinges on which player maintains consistency in baseline rallies and capitalizes on break opportunities.
